| Modifier and Type | Method and Description |
|---|---|
DataModel |
XMLConfigParser.getDataModelByName(String name) |
static DataModel |
XMLConfigParser.readDataModel(Path file)
Unmarshall an XML data file
|
| Modifier and Type | Method and Description |
|---|---|
List<DataModel> |
XMLConfigParser.getDataModels() |
| Modifier and Type | Method and Description |
|---|---|
static void |
XMLConfigParser.writeDataModel(DataModel data,
OutputStream output) |
| Modifier and Type | Class and Description |
|---|---|
class |
DataModelResult |
| Constructor and Description |
|---|
DataModelResult(DataModel dataModel) |
DataModelResult(DataModel dataModel,
String zookeeper) |
| Constructor and Description |
|---|
RulesApplier(DataModel model) |
RulesApplier(DataModel model,
long seed) |
| Modifier and Type | Method and Description |
|---|---|
protected Callable<Void> |
QueryExecutor.executeAllScenarios(DataModel dataModel)
Execute all scenarios
|
protected Callable<Void> |
QueryExecutor.exportAllScenarios(DataModel dataModel)
Export all queries results to CSV
|
| Constructor and Description |
|---|
QueryExecutor(XMLConfigParser parser,
PhoenixUtil util,
WorkloadExecutor workloadExecutor,
List<DataModel> dataModels,
String queryHint,
boolean exportCSV) |
QueryExecutor(XMLConfigParser parser,
PhoenixUtil util,
WorkloadExecutor workloadExecutor,
List<DataModel> dataModels,
String queryHint,
boolean exportCSV,
boolean writeRuntimeResults) |
| Constructor and Description |
|---|
MultiTenantWorkload(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ario,
List<PherfWorkHandler> workHandlers,
Properties properties) |
MultiTenantWorkload(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ario,
Properties properties) |
| Modifier and Type | Method and Description |
|---|---|
DataModel |
LoadEventGenerator.getModel() |
DataModel |
BaseLoadEventGenerator.getModel() |
| Modifier and Type | Method and Description |
|---|---|
LoadEventGenerator<TenantOperationInfo> |
TenantLoadEventGeneratorFactory.newLoadEventGenerator(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ario,
List<PherfWorkHandler> workHandlers,
Properties properties) |
LoadEventGenerator<T> |
LoadEventGeneratorFactory.newLoadEventGenerator(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ario,
List<PherfWorkHandler> workHandlers,
Properties properties) |
LoadEventGenerator<TenantOperationInfo> |
TenantLoadEventGeneratorFactory.newLoadEventGenerator(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ario,
Properties properties) |
LoadEventGenerator<T> |
LoadEventGeneratorFactory.newLoadEventGenerator(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ario,
Properties properties) |
| Modifier and Type | Method and Description |
|---|---|
DataModel |
TenantOperationFactory.getModel() |
| Constructor and Description |
|---|
BaseOperationSupplier(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ario) |
IdleTimeOperationSupplier(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ario) |
PreScenarioOperationSupplier(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ario) |
QueryOperationSupplier(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ario) |
TenantOperationFactory(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ario) |
UpsertOperationSupplier(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ario) |
UserDefinedOperationSupplier(PhoenixUtil phoenixUtil,
DataModel model,
Scenario scenario) |
Copyright © 2022 Apache Software Foundation. All rights reserved.